A decomposition group is a subgroup of the Galois group that describes how a prime ideal in a number field splits into prime ideals in an extension field. It provides insight into the behavior of prime ideals under field extensions, revealing whether a prime remains irreducible or decomposes into several factors. Understanding decomposition groups is crucial for analyzing ramification and inertia, especially when exploring the structure of field extensions.
